Temporary closure on Graves Creek Road
A temporary road closure has been ordered on a portion of Graves Creek Road due to hazards associated with ongoing road construction.
Effective July 7 through August 1, the closure will apply to Forest Service Road 367 (Graves Creek Road) at mile post 2.8 to milepost 6.0 at the intersection with Forest Road 7679 (Irv’s Creek Road).
The closure is necessary to ensure public safety while construction activities are underway and to allow for safe and efficient completion of the project. Forest users are advised to plan ahead and use alternate routes during the closure period. Signs and notices will be posted at key access points and trailheads.

On the Missoula Ranger District, a stream improvement project is underway on Forest Road 699 above the Lee Creek Campground.
The project will result in the temporary closure of Road 699 above the Lee Creek campground from July 7 through Sept. 30 to allow for the replacement of three culverts on Lee Creek Road.
Existing under sized culverts will be replaced with Aquatic Organism Passage (AOP) structures, which are designed to improve fish passage and restore natural stream function. This project will improve aquatic habitat and enhance long-term stream health in the upper Lolo Creek watershed.
Access to Lee Creek Campground will remain open and unaffected throughout the duration of the project. Visitors are encouraged to plan accordingly and respect posted signage and closures for their safety and the protection of ongoing work.
Forest visitors should anticipate construction activity in the area and plan for alternate routes if traveling beyond the Lee Creek Campground.
